3 Tips For Choosing The Right Patio Furniture

by Jamie Carpenter

If you have a porch or patio, then having the right furnishings is essential when it comes to allowing you to enjoy these outdoor areas. Patio furniture not only provides you and your guests with outdoor seating, it also helps to create a design aesthetic that will define your outdoor living space.

Here are three tips that you can use to help select the perfect patio furniture for your porch, patio, or deck in the future.

1. Think about the ways that you use your outdoor living area.

Before investing in patio furniture, it's important that you take the time to consider all the ways in which you use your outdoor living space. You want furniture that will serve as an asset to your outdoor area, so you need to invest in functional pieces.

If you use your patio as a place to gather and enjoy lively discussions, then ample seating is required. If your outdoor living space plays host to BBQ dinners and other meals, then you will need tables in addition to seating.

Considering the ways that you use your outdoor living area will help you determine which types of patio furniture are needed to facilitate these uses.

2. Select furniture that is easy to maintain.

Most patio furniture will be left outdoors for a majority of the year. This means that your furnishings will be exposed to the elements on a regular basis. The last thing you want to do is spend time repairing patio furniture that has started to deteriorate as a result of this exposure.

Look for furniture items that are made from durable materials like cedar or wicker. These materials are easy to maintain and designed to withstand extended exposure to the elements, making them the perfect materials for outdoor furniture.

3. Make sure your furniture is neutral.

One of the biggest mistakes that homeowners make when it comes to investing in patio furniture is purchasing pieces that are too trendy. If you want to ensure that your outdoor furniture can withstand the test of time, invest in items that have a neutral design.

Don't purchase brightly-colored furniture that could go out of style quickly. Instead, add a splash of color through cushions and other accessories since these items are much more affordable to replace than your actual outdoor furniture.
